What is the Blue Star Connection?
This is just one of the Grand County Blues Society
program under the Blues in The School Umbrella Blues in
the school here means where children learn about music
Not all children get to be in the red brick school
house Sometimes school is a hospital room and all by
yourself or your bedroom at home in the middle of the
night We are going to reach out to children all over
the country who are dealing with cancer, life
threatening disease Basically any kid with a hard road
to travel. We are going to reach out in two basics
ways. We are going to get instruments in thier hands if
they are in need Blue Stars can receive an electric
guitar and amp. Blue Stars can have nice acoustic
guitar They do get a real kick out of the power and
noise of the electric instruments Keyboards have now
gained a lot of popularity We get almost as many
requests for keyboards now as guitars We also have
found horns, flutes, and a violin can fill the bill as
well as drums. all net proceeds go to Blue Star
Connection
